The Pros and Cons of Joining a Writing Group

As any writer can tell you, writing is a solitary pursuit, and most writers are solitary creatures, quite content to work alone. Still, writers can often benefit by the company of others with similar goals and dreams, so many writers turn to writing groups. Whether meeting in local, public places or in an online format only, writing groups can be a blessing for a writer.

How To Read Efficiently

Before start reading a document ask yourself the following questions: What is my purpose? How much time have I got? What is the nature of the document? How long is it? Author? Origin? Style? Who is it written for? Table of contents?
